About Mohamed Saad

Mohamed Saad is a scholar working on Critical Care and Intensive Care Medicine, Ceramics and Composites and Inorganic Chemistry, having authored 44 papers that have together received 465 indexed citations. Recurring topics across this work include Radiation Shielding Materials Analysis (8 papers), Graphite, nuclear technology, radiation studies (6 papers) and Advanced Photocatalysis Techniques (5 papers). The work is most often cited by research in Endocrine and Autonomic Systems (64 citations), Ceramics and Composites (31 citations) and Materials Chemistry (172 citations). Mohamed Saad has collaborated with scholars based in Egypt, Saudi Arabia and United States. Frequent co-authors include Hussain Almohiy, Rizk Mostafa Shalaby, Abdelaziz M. Aboraia, Abdelmoneim Saleh, Vikram Kamdar, Arshad M. Khan, Rima Boyadjian, Ronald L. Gingerich, Sujata Jinagouda and Hassanien Gomaa. Their work appears in journals such as SHILAP Revista de lepidopterología, The Journal of Clinical Endocrinology & Metabolism and CHEST Journal.
